Plant dyeing techniques

Plant dyeing techniques involve using natural plant materials—such as leaves, stems, roots, or bark—to produce color on fabrics. The process typically includes harvesting plant parts, preparing a dye bath by boiling them to extract pigments, and then immersing the fabric into this solution. Sometimes, mordants (substances like alum or iron) are added to fix the dye and enhance colorfastness. Variations like tie-dyeing or bundling can create patterns. Natural dyeing is eco-friendly, offering earthy hues and subtle tones, and requires patience for color development and fixation, resulting in unique, sustainable textiles.
